Add internal-schema versioning + auto-migration for __manifest The on-disk shape of `__manifest` is reconciled with the binary via a single stamp + dispatcher in `db/manifest/migrations.rs`: - `INTERNAL_MANIFEST_SCHEMA_VERSION = 2` declares the shape this binary writes. - The on-disk stamp `omnigraph:internal_schema_version` lives in the manifest dataset's schema-level metadata (Lance `update_schema_metadata`). - `migrate_internal_schema(&mut dataset)` walks `match`-arm steps forward from the on-disk stamp until it matches the binary, then returns. Idempotent. - `init_manifest_repo` stamps the current version at creation; the publisher's open-for-write path runs pending migrations before reading state. Reads stay side-effect-free. - Forward-version protection: a stamp higher than the binary's known version triggers a clear "upgrade omnigraph first" error so an old binary cannot clobber a newer schema. Self-heals existing pre-MR-766 deployments by auto-applying the v1→v2 step: the `lance-schema:unenforced-primary-key` annotation on `__manifest.object_id` that engages Lance's row-level CAS at commit time. New repos created via `init` are stamped at v2 immediately and don't need migration. Adding a future on-disk shape change is one constant bump, one match arm in `migrate_internal_schema`, and one test — no new branches in unrelated code paths. Code outside the migration module never inspects the stamp. fix(optimize): skip blob-bearing tables to avoid Lance compaction crash (#138) * test(optimize): pin Lance blob-column compaction failure as a surface guard Lance compact_files mis-decodes blob-v2 columns under its forced BlobHandling::AllBinary read ("more fields in the schema than provided column indices"), failing even a pristine uniform-V2_2 multi-fragment blob table; reads use descriptor handling and are unaffected. Guard 10 reproduces this and is self-retiring: it turns red on the Lance bump that fixes the bug, forcing LANCE_SUPPORTS_BLOB_COMPACTION to flip. * fix(optimize): skip blob-bearing tables instead of crashing compaction omnigraph optimize aborted the whole sweep when any node/edge table had a Blob property: Lance compact_files cannot decode blob-v2 columns under AllBinary (the column-index error pinned by the surface guard). Skip blob-bearing tables behind a LANCE_SUPPORTS_BLOB_COMPACTION gate and report them via TableOptimizeStats.skipped / SkipReason (surfaced in the CLI and a tracing::warn) instead of erroring, which also isolates the failure so the other tables still compact. Reads/writes are unaffected; only fragment/space reclamation on blob tables is deferred until the upstream Lance fix.
